The West Hollywood Travel and Tourism Board, also known as Visit West Hollywood, is teaming up with the West Hollywood Chamber of Commerce for the return of its celebrated Eat + Drink Week series, featuring special promotions and unique menus from the city’s top dining venues this November. The 10-day festival kicks off on November 3 with creative cuisines and innovative craft cocktails that the city is known for. All participating restaurants and bars are unique to West Hollywood city limits.
During West Hollywood’s Eat + Drink Week, participating businesses will dazzle taste buds with specially curated menus, discounted prices, and/or unique culinary creations. Eat + Drink Week 2023 also coincides with the release of an exclusive new cocktail book titled “Once Upon a Cocktail – West Hollywood,” highlighting coveted cocktail recipes from West Hollywood’s A-list hotels and restaurants. West Hollywood’s Eat + Drink Week starts Friday, November 3 and runs through Sunday, November 12. For more information and to see the additional offers that are being added, please visit the official event website at eatanddrinkweek.com.
